- 5.0 (4)·Moderate·31.4 mi·Est. 12–13.5 hrVaried mountain bike tour on Lake Starnberg, Bavaria. A beautiful loop trip east of Lake Starnberg. The route can be started, for example, in Achmuehle or at the Iffeldorf train station. Kilometers 28 to 42, which lead through the Osterseen nature reserve and along the shore of Lake Starnberg, are particularly scenic. The mountain bike tour can be done in one go or in several daily stages. Highlights of the tour: - Starnberger Lake - Loisach - Old and new pond - Osterseen nature reserve
- 4.8 (2)·Hard·38.6 mi·Est. 15.5–17 hrThis is Stage 4 of the Issarrun and begins in the heart of Wolfratshausen. The route follows the Isar River through Bad Tölz and Lenggries to the Sylvenstein Reservoir. It can be run, hiked, or mountain biked. Mountain bikers should be prepared for sections where they’ll have to push their bikes in the first part of the route. Here, there are barely any rideable trails, with numerous fallen trees.
